CVE-2025-37099 is a critical remote code execution vulnerability affecting HPE Insight Remote Support (IRS) versions prior to 7.15.0.646. With a CVSS score of 9.8, this vulnerability allows un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code over the network with low attack complexity, leading to compl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While there is no known active exploitation, public exploit code, or KEV listing, the vulnerability has garnered significant community discussion, indicating potential interest. Organizations using affected HPE IRS versions should prioritize patching to mitigate this severe risk.
